The GeForce 930MX is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in March 1 2016. It features the Maxwell architecture. The core clock ranges from 952 MHz to 1020 MHz. It has 384 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 17W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 1,278 points.

NVIDIA

GeForce GT 745A

The GeForce GT 745A is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in August 26 2013. It features the Kepler architecture. The core clock ranges from 837 MHz to 915 MHz. It has 384 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 33W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 1,234 points.

Graphics Performance

The GeForce 930MX scores 1,278 and the GeForce GT 745A reaches 1,234 in the G3D Mark benchmark — just a 3.6% difference, making them near-identical in rasterization performance. The GeForce 930MX is built on Maxwell while the GeForce GT 745A uses Kepler, both on a 28 nm process. Shader units: 384 (GeForce 930MX) vs 384 (GeForce GT 745A). Raw compute: 0.7834 TFLOPS (GeForce 930MX) vs 0.7027 TFLOPS (GeForce GT 745A). Boost clocks: 1020 MHz vs 915 MHz.

Video Memory (VRAM)

The GeForce 930MX has 2 GB of VRAM, while the GeForce GT 745A carries 512 MB. GeForce 930MX gives you 300% more memory capacity, which matters more once you move into heavier textures, mods, or higher resolutions. Memory bus width is 128-bit on the GeForce 930MX and 64-bit on the GeForce GT 745A. L2 Cache: 1 MB (GeForce 930MX) vs 0.25 MB (GeForce GT 745A) — the GeForce 930MX has significantly larger on-die cache to reduce VRAM reliance.

Display & API Support

DirectX support: 12 (11_0) (GeForce 930MX) vs 12 (11_0) (GeForce GT 745A). Vulkan: 1.1 vs 1.2. OpenGL: 4.6 vs 4.6. Maximum simultaneous displays: 0 vs 4.

Media & Encoding

Hardware encoder: None (GeForce 930MX) vs NVENC (1st Gen) (GeForce GT 745A). Decoder: PureVideo HD (VP6) vs PureVideo HD VP5. Supported codecs: H.264,MPEG-2,VC-1 (GeForce 930MX) vs H.264,VC-1,MPEG-2 (GeForce GT 745A).

Power & Dimensions

The GeForce 930MX draws 17W versus the GeForce GT 745A's 33W — a 64% difference. The GeForce 930MX is more power-efficient. Recommended PSU: 350W (GeForce 930MX) vs 350W (GeForce GT 745A). Power connectors: PCIe-powered vs PCIe-powered. Typical load temperature: 80 vs 80°C.
